* POSITION OVERVIEW: *The *Medical Assistant *will be responsible for daily patient flow for each respective physician for whom they work. Must use triage skills to gather information from which designated staff can make appropriate patient health assessments and to anticipate physician's needs as they relate to the patients' medical care.*

This position does not manage any other caregivers.

*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ND DUTIES:*

Escorts patients to exam rooms and prep for physician assessment.

Records and maintains patient's medical data in patient's medical chart.

Assists physician with answering phone requests from patients and/or other medical professionals and institutions.

Performs a variety of physician-requested ancillary and/or surgical patient procedures. (This excludes the administration of IV medication.)

Maintains equipment, instruments supply inventory levels.

*EDUCATION:*

*Required: *High school diploma or GED.
*Preferred: *Graduate of an accredited Medical Assistant program.

*LICENSURE/CERTIFICATION/REGISTRATION:*

*Required: *Current MA Certification from one of the following: The American Medical Technology Association (AMT), The National Center for Competency Testing (NCCT), The American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A), The National Association for Health Professionals (NAHP) Certification, National Healthcareer Association (NHA) or licensure as an intermediate or paramedic level EMT, Oregon LPN, or Oregon RN.
AHA Basic Life Support for Healthcare Provider certification.
Ability to travel to business functions/trainings/meetings and all St. Charles Health System worksites.
*Preferred: *Current American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A) certification

*EXPERIENCE:*

*Required:* Must have basic knowledge of ICD-10, CM/CPT/HCPCS coding conventions and procedures. Working knowledge of medical practice management information systems. Basic knowledge of physician office documentation standards. Must be able to maintain confidentiality and meet all HIPAA requirements.
Those candidates with NHA certification that qualified due to work experience rather than graduation from an accredited Medical Assisting Program will be required to have one (1) year of experience in Medical Assisting.
*Preferred: *Two (2) years of Medical Assisting experience.
